In the Rajya Sabha, Arun Jaitley raises the issue of the US high-handedness in dealing with Indian envoys. He says India must ensure that necessary steps must be taken in the diplomat case and said it raised serious questions on the way India conducted its foreign policy that it was taken for granted. He said it was time the government introspected on where it stands on foreign policy.

Ms Mayawati says the Dalit community is really upset because the government reacted late because Devyani Khobragade came from a lower caste. She said the method of strip-searching the diplomat was unacceptable. She said her party was outraged as Devyani Khobragade belonged to a weaker section of society.

CPI-M'S Sitaram Yechury says his boarding pass to the US comes with a four-level security. He says he always tells himself that other people have been subjected to worse, but the point remains that we allow this to happen. "We accept that the US is the world's policeman and it can get away with laws it sets for the world. You cannot violate the Panchsheel. There has to be mutual respect for each other."
